Singapore leader defends gay sex
Singapore’s former Prime Minister Lee Kuan Yew, and father of current PM Lee Hsien Loong, said that gay sex should be decriminalised. Lee Kuan Yew, who served as PM from 1959 to 1990, spoke at a youth rally on Saturday and suggested that the government should refrain from making moral judgements. [...]
